Why Choose the Lovato ME024RSD024 Electronic Reversing Starter?
The Lovato ME024RSD024 is a compact electronic reversing motor starter with integrated STO (Safe Torque Off), designed to provide forward/reverse motor control, electronic switching and motor thermal protection in a single device. It has a rated operational current of 2.4 A AC-3 / AC-53a and supports operational voltages from 40–500 V AC.
Unlike conventional reversing arrangements that require multiple electromechanical contactors and interlocking components, the ME024RSD024 integrates the reversing function electronically. Its built-in Class 10A thermal motor protection has an adjustable trip range of 0.18–2.4 A, allowing the starter to be configured for the rated current of the connected motor.
For safety-related machine applications, the ME024RSD024 incorporates a Safe Torque Off (STO) function rated to SIL 3 according to IEC 61508 and Performance Level e according to ISO 13849-1. A 24 V DC auxiliary and control supply, diagnostic outputs and compact construction make it a versatile solution for modern industrial automation and machine-control systems.

Integrated Reversing, Motor Protection and Functional Safety
The ME024RSD024 combines several functions traditionally implemented using separate motor-control components. Electronic forward/reverse switching provides the reversing function, while the integrated Class 10A thermal protection monitors the motor load and can be adjusted from 0.18–2.4 A to suit the connected motor.
Its integrated STO safety function provides a means of preventing torque generation when correctly incorporated into the machine safety system. With safety capability up to SIL 3 and PL e, the ME024RSD024 is particularly suited to modern machinery where compact motor control and safety-related stopping functions need to be coordinated within the automation architecture.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the Lovato ME024RSD024?
The ME024RSD024 is a 2.4 A electronic reversing motor starter with integrated Class 10A thermal motor protection and a built-in STO (Safe Torque Off) safety function.
What motor current range can the ME024RSD024 protect?
The integrated thermal protection has an adjustable trip range of 0.18–2.4 A, allowing it to be matched to a suitable motor within this range.
What supply voltages does the ME024RSD024 support?
The motor-side rated operational voltage range is 40–500 V AC at 50/60 Hz, while the starter requires a 24 V DC auxiliary and control supply.
Does the ME024RSD024 include Safe Torque Off?
Yes. The ME024RSD024 incorporates a built-in STO safety function with safety capability up to SIL 3 according to IEC 61508 and PL e according to ISO 13849-1.
What outputs are available on the ME024RSD024?
The starter provides three outputs: one relay output with a changeover contact and two 24 V DC PNP digital outputs for signalling and control-system integration.
